0) Prima di iniziare
Assicurati di avere una configurazione del server hardware adeguata adeguata come descritto qui. Devono essere rispettate le seguenti condizioni:
- Webbservern utvecklar fullständig åtkomst till alla publicerade kartor, filer, loggfiler, tmp => EJ EGEN INSTALLATÖR DEN REDMINE MED L'UTENTE ROT!
- Webbservern Webrick NON è supportato
- Jag plugin för Easy Redmine i [redmine_root]/plugins/easyproject/easy_plugins
- La procedura di aggiornamento contiene la migrazione della formattazione del testo. Om du använder Textile eller Markdown (som är standard i Redmine och finns tillgängligt i version 10 av Easy Redmine), testar jag att konvertera HTML i HTML-stöd för CKEditor 5. Alcune funzionalità (come "toc") saranno rimosse.
- L'installazione NON imposta automaticamente CRON - devi farlo manualmente
- Per il corretto funzionamento dell'installatore di Redmine, sono richiesti almeno 250 MB di spazio libero sul disco root
- Servern utvecklas utan anslutning till internet, men är alltid installerad
- Redmine non può contenere plugin eller modifiche di terze parti. Maggiori informazioni al punto 2.1 dei termini di installazione
- Prima di aggiornare Easy Redmine esistente, controlla il contenuto delle cartelle dei plugin nella tua installazione corrente e nel pacchetto di aggiornamento (/plugins e /plugins/easyproject/easy_plugins). Se il pacchetto di aggiornamento manca di alcuni plugin presenti nell'installazione corrente, scrivi a support@easyredmine.com per scoprire il motivo e ottenere il pacchetto corretto. Uppure avinstallera och plugin-excessiv dal ditt system
È disponibile anche un manuale di installazione dettagliato direttamente nel pacchetto in doc/INSTALL
1) redmine Installer Ruby Gem
Första hand, devi installera Redmine Installer Ruby Gem. Per installationare la gem, usa:
$ gem installera redmine-installer
(O pärla uppdatering redmine-installer per aggionare la gemma esistente all'ultima versione.)
Quando la gemma dell'installatore è installata/aggiornata nel tuo Ruby, puoi iniziare con l'aggiornamento.
Richiedi il download dell'installatore!
2) Aggiornamento dell'istanza di Redmine esistente
Redmine-installatören gör det möjligt att installera Redmine i ett arkiv eller ett git. I plugin installati vengono mantenuti o aggiornati se il nuovo pacchetto li contiene.
La procedura di aggiornamento può essere salvata in un profilo per il prossimo aggiornamento. Jag minns min profil i HOME_FOLDER/.redmine-installer-profiles.yml
Commando per l'aggiornamento:
redmine uppgradering [PATH_TO_PACKAGE] [REDMINE_ROOT]
La procedura guidata di aggiornamento ti guida attraverso i seguenti passaggi:
1) Redmine Root - definisci dove è installato il tuo Redmine (se non l'hai già incluso nel comando)
2) Caricamento del pacchetto - caricamento del pacchetto nella cartella temporanea
3) Convalida di Redmine corrente
4) Backup - komplett / konfigurering + databas / solo databas
5) Aggiornamento - vengono eseguiti i comandi di aggiornamento
6) Spostamento di Redmine - il Redmine corrente viene aggiornato con i nuovi fil
7) Salvataggio del profilo - la procedura di aggiornamento viene salvata per l'uso futuro
Comando per l'aggiornamento di Redmine - da archivio
redmine uppgradering [PATH_TO_PACKAGE] [REDMINE_ROOT]
exempel
redmine upgrade easyredmine_2016_stable_u11271_v2018_1_2__platform_04_00.zip /home/easy/current
Comando per l'aggiornamento di Redmine - da profil
redmine uppgradering [PACKAGE] [REDMINE_ROOT] --profil PROFILE_ID
Aggiornamento con modifiche personalizzate
Se stai usando il plugin easyproject e non vuoi copiare le modifiche del client dalla vecchia istanza, usa lo switch
-skip-old-modifications